How to make your own Zinema

1. Approach your filmmaking as you would approach making a zine. Yep.

2. Make it with the resources you have on hand (don’t go renting an Arri Alexa for this thing).

3. Tell a story from your soul - it can be documentary, narrative, animation, or whatever combination works for you as a creative.

4. The purpose is for sharing your zinematic experience with others, not for profit. If you aren’t willing to do a free screening, perhaps you aren’t making it for the right reasons.

5. It’s important that you showcase your work! Rent out an arthouse theater, coffeeshop, do a backyard screening, or put it on YouTube. Whatever you can afford/organize.

6. Fuck off. Make this movie despite the fact that Hollywood, art dorks, and your mom will probably say it’s bad. Make it for you, and for your friends who love the work you make.

7. These are just guidelines. Do it however you want. I don’t care. Just send it over to us through our website and we’ll share it on our website/insta/other platforms.

Zinema through history

Scotty Leonard’s “The Space Between Dreams” is one of the earliest experiments in Zinema.

Evelyn Witterholt’s “da big apl” is the first film to feature the word “Zinema” in it.

Andy’s Chair #4 was an unreleased zine from 1993 that was shot on VHS. While it never uses the word “zinema,” it is the first example of a zine movie that I can find and therefore I’m sharing it here.
